JPMorgan and BofA explore acquisition of Fiserv debit network - WSJ

Consolidation at the debit network layer would reshape interchange economics and routing optionality for every issuer running on a competing network — if the largest US banks absorb Fiserv's debit rails, they gain direct leverage over routing decisions that Regulation II mandates remain competitive, forcing regulators to scrutinize whether bank-owned network infrastructure undermines the debit routing parity the rule was designed to protect.
